I eat the toppings off and then chew on a tiny strip of the hard crust - it's much like having a cracker. I don't think I will ever have a regular whole slice of pizza again unless it's on very thin crust.

Yeah - way too soon for pizza. I was still on Clear liquids at that point. In a few days you should be on full liquids. Really, you could do yourself harm.

Loaded potato skins? Not for me maybe ever. I simply will not go back to my old way of eating.

Dense Protein first, a little vegetable or fruit, if ANY room left maybe a bit of complex carbs.

It's not suffering. Hell, I had a piece of ribeye steak last night. Today I'm having grilled shrimp for lunch with a snack of a little slice of Havarti dill and a large strawberry.
